DIRECTIONAL VALVE

They allow various risks to be protected simultaneously with a single w-fog high-pressure water mist system. They are activated by the fire panel signal, directing the supply of pressurised water toward the enclosure or section affected by the fire.

The installation is simple: the valve is placed over each individual risk or section of the network.


 

In the event of activation, the water flows through the common branch of pipe until it reaches the collector for control valves, normally closed. The signal from the panel opens the valve that governs that sector, with which the agent is channelled without needing duplicate equipment or piping.
